What is Pool Coping and Why is It Important?

Pool coping refers to the material used to cap the edge of a swimming pool, providing a finished look while serving several crucial functions. It acts as a transition between the water and the deck, helping prevent water from splashing onto the surrounding areas. Additionally, pool coping:

  • Enhances safety by creating a stable, slip-resistant surface.
  • Protects the pool shell from water damage and cracking.
  • Provides aesthetic appeal, contributing to the overall design of the pool area.

Types of Natural Stone for Pool Coping

Various types of natural stone are available for pool coping, each offering unique characteristics. Here are some popular options:

1. Travertine

Travertine is a popular choice due to its porous texture, which provides a slip-resistant surface. Its natural color variations range from light creams to rich browns, making it versatile for various outdoor designs.

2. Bluestone

Known for its stunning blue-gray hue, bluestone offers a classic, sophisticated look. It is also incredibly durable and provides excellent traction.

3. Limestone

Limestone is appreciated for its natural beauty and soft texture. It comes in a variety of colors and is usually more affordable than other natural stones.

4. Granite

Granite is one of the hardest natural stones, making it resistant to chips and scratches. Its striking appearance adds a luxurious touch to any pool deck.

Installation of Natural Stone Pool Coping

Proper installation of natural stone pool coping is essential for longevity and functionality. Here are the key steps involved:

1. Preparation

Before starting, ensure the pool area is clean and dry. Remove any debris and old coping materials if necessary.

2. Measurements

Accurate measurements are crucial to ensure that the stones fit perfectly. Measure the length and width of the pool edge to determine how much stone you will need.

3. Choosing Adhesive

Select a high-quality adhesive that is suitable for outdoor use. Mortar-based adhesives are often preferred for their strong bonding properties.

4. Laying the Stones

Begin laying the stones along the edge of the pool, ensuring they fit snugly together. Use spacers to maintain uniform gaps if you plan to grout the seams.

5. Finishing Touches

Once all stones are laid, allow the adhesive to cure as per the manufacturer’s instructions. After curing, apply grout if desired, and seal the stones to protect against staining and water damage.

Maintenance of Natural Stone Pool Coping

To keep your natural stone pool coping looking great, maintenance is key. Here are some tips:

1. Regular Cleaning

Clean the stone regularly with a soft brush and mild soap solution to remove dirt and algae buildup.

2. Sealant Application

Apply a sealant every few years to protect the stone from stains and water damage, especially in high-use areas.

3. Repairing Chips and Cracks

If any chips or cracks occur, use a stone repair kit to fix them promptly to prevent further damage.
